Description
m-(2-Nitro-1-Propenyl)Phenol is a specialized phenolic intermediate featuring a nitroalkene functional group. This unique molecular structure makes it a valuable building block in advanced organic synthesis, particularly for constructing complex heterocyclic systems and functional materials. It is primarily sought by research and development chemists in the pharmaceutical and agrochemical industries for creating novel active ingredients and fine chemicals.
Application
- Pharmaceutical Intermediate: Key precursor in the synthesis of novel drug candidates, especially those containing complex phenolic or nitro-substituted heterocycles.
- Agrochemical Synthesis: Used in the research and development of new pesticides and herbicides, leveraging its reactive nitroalkene moiety.
- Organic Synthesis Building Block: Serves as a versatile electrophile or dienophile in various name reactions (e.g., Michael additions, Diels-Alder reactions) for constructing complex molecular architectures.
- Material Science Research: Potential monomer or cross-linking agent in the development of specialty polymers and functional organic materials.
- Chemical Research & Development: A valuable reagent for academic and industrial R&D labs exploring new synthetic methodologies and reaction pathways.
Basic Information
| Product Name | m-(2-Nitro-1-Propenyl)Phenol |
| CAS No. | 61131-60-0 |
| Molecular Formula | C9H9NO3 |
| Molecular Weight | 179.17 g/mol |
| Synonyms | 3-(2-Nitroprop-1-en-1-yl)phenol; 2-Nitro-1-(3-hydroxyphenyl)-1-propene; Phenol, m-(2-nitro-1-propenyl)-; m-(2-Nitrovinyl)phenol (related); 3-Hydroxy-β-methyl-β-nitrostyrene |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ated place at room temperature (15-25°C). Keep away from heat, sparks, and open flame. Due to its light-sensitive nature, minimize exposure during handling.
